We are seeking a strategic and results-driven Procurement Specialist to lead the sourcing and onboarding of independent haulers to support our final mile delivery operations. This role is pivotal in ensuring reliable, cost-effective, and scalable transportation solutions by building a robust network of independent carriers. The ideal candidate will have strong negotiation skills, a deep understanding of the logistics industry, and the ability to manage vendor relationships with precision and professionalism.
Key Responsibilities:- Independent Hauler Sourcing & Onboarding Identify, evaluate, and recruit independent haulers to meet regional and national delivery needs. Develop sourcing strategies to attract high-performing carriers, including outreach campaigns, industry networking, and digital platforms. Lead onboarding processes including contract negotiation, compliance checks, and system integration.
- Vendor Management Maintain strong relationships with haulers to ensure service quality, reliability, and performance. Monitor KPIs such as on-time delivery, claims, and customer satisfaction; implement corrective actions as needed. Conduct regular business reviews and performance evaluations.
- Contract Negotiation & Compliance Negotiate competitive rates and service terms while ensuring alignment with company standards. Ensure all haulers meet legal, safety, and insurance requirements. Collaborate with legal and compliance teams to manage contract lifecycle and risk mitigation.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ration Work closely with operations, finance, and technology teams to align procurement strategies with business goals. Support implementation of new delivery markets or service expansions by securing hauler capacity.
- Market Intelligence & Strategy Stay informed on industry trends, regional capacity shifts, and regulatory changes affecting independent haulers. Provide insights and recommendations to improve sourcing efficiency and cost control.
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Business Administration, or related field (or equivalent experience). 3+ years of experience in procurement, logistics, or transportation sourcing, preferably with independent contractors. Strong negotiation and vendor management skills. Familiarity with transportation management systems (TMS) and procurement platforms. Excellent communication, analytical, and organizational skills.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
PreferredSkills:
Experience in final mile delivery or gig economy logistics. Knowledge of DOT regulations and carrier compliance standards. Bilingual (English/Spanish) a plus for broader hauler engagement.
